What are the 3 lights on Hue Bridge?

First, it’s worth checking that your Philips Hue Bridge has an internet connection. All three lights at the top of the Bridge should be on. In order, they are the power button, network connection button and internet connection button. If the first is off, there’s a power issue (and both the other lights will be off).

How do I connect two hue bridges to Alexa?

-Set up my 2nd Bridge for a few rooms in my house. -Confirm the Hue App is logged in with the 2nd MeetHue Account that is attached to the new Bridge. -Re-add Hue Skill on Alexa, use the new MeetHue account to login. Alexa will than discover all the new devices on the 2nd bridge.

Is Philips Hue a Zigbee?

The Philips Hue bridge uses the Zigbee Light Link standard, which makes it, according to Philips, compatible to all such light bulbs and devices.Products using the ZigBee HA standard are, by current knowledge, not compatible with the Hue bridge.

How many Hue bulbs can I have?

50 bulb
The Hue Bridge – with an advertised 50 bulb limit – actually has a hard limit of 63 lights (and 62 accessories), however you may start having performance issues above 40-45 lights and above 12 accessories. Buying a second Hue Bridge is the only real solution, even though this has some issues in itself.

Do Zigbee lights repeat?

Sengled zigbee bulbs are unusual in that they do not repeat for anything, not even other bulbs. Other than that, when it comes to ZigBee and Z-Wave, most mains-powered devices repeat for their own protocol. So if it plugs in or is hardwired, and it’s not a smoke alarm, it probably repeats.

Is Hue a mesh network?

Hue uses Zigbee, and Zigbee is told to to support a “Mesh Networking” topology. So if you have devices in your house, that are not reachable by the bridge directly, other (permanently powered) devices can act as gateway to distant devices.
